Summary:碩士 === 國立臺灣科技大學 === 建築系 === 97 === Subsurface Scattering is one of the most hot research topic in the recently years. This translucent technique is mainly applied to simulate the real lighting effect from the inside of a non-fully translucent material. This special lighting effect can let an object’s surface looks like more soft and layering. In addition, the most important of this lightning effect is to let the material looks like more real and enrich the visual feelings of the audience. Because of this reason, this study will focus on the application of translucent material in the 3D environment. This study will discuss the visual effects of subsurface scattering from a real material. Based on this concept, how to simulate the translucent material in a effective way and the what the difference of convenience and effects between related materials is will be discussed through the related setup of light and material technique in the 3D environment. Finally, this study will separate into two parts. One is try to use the Maya BRDF material and related utilities to show the translucent visual effects of a material, for example, skin. The other is to use Mental Ray 3S material to simulate the translucent material, such as grape and milk etc.
